
Assembly elections have been completed in Madhya Pradesh. Exit polls have also come out and now everyone is eagerly waiting for Sunday because Sunday is the day when the position of all the parties will become clear and it will be known whether 'Shiv Ka Raj' will continue or Kamal Nath will shine. Meanwhile,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an claimed that all the projections made so far will fail.
Did CM Shivraj say anything?
According to news agency ANI,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an said that he is getting love and affection from his beloved sisters as well as nephews and nieces. They said,
'Everything will be clear tomorrow'
He said that love and blessings have been showered all around from every section of society. The dear sisters have given blessings and the nephews and nieces have also not held back. Overall, the BJP has received unprecedented support and we are going to form the government here with an overwhelming majority. All the estimates so far will fail. I am not saying anything today, tomorrow everything will become clear like sunlight.
It should be noted that voting for the 230-member Madhya Pradesh Assembly was held on November 17, while the election results will be known on December 3. In such a situation, all the political parties are claiming their respective victories.
